Nanofiber ceramic high-heat-insulation sun-shading adhesive film as well as preparation method and application thereof
The invention discloses a nanofiber ceramic high-heat-insulation sun-shading adhesive film as well as a preparation method and application thereof, and relates to the technical field of high polymer materials. The preparation method comprises the following steps: when the nanofiber ceramic high-heat-insulation sun-shading adhesive film is prepared, firstly, nanofiber ceramic reacts with triethoxysilane, 4-vinylphenol, 2-nitroaniline, a diazonium salt solution and hydrogen in sequence to prepare modified nanofiber ceramic; and mixing an acrylic pressure-sensitive adhesive, toluene and the modified nanofiber ceramic, coating a matte release film with the mixture, and drying to form the nanofiber ceramic high-heat-insulation sun-shading adhesive film. The nanofiber ceramic high-heat-insulation sun-shading adhesive film prepared by the invention has excellent heat insulation performance and ultraviolet shielding effect.
